of the months of summer at Canyon Park highs are generally in the 80's, and during the night it cools down to the 50's. Through the winter highs are generally in the 40's while the cold winter nights at Canyon Park are in the 20's. Here at Canyon Park you can distinguish Mount
R, and the Green Valley Trail offers hiking at its best. Canyon Park gets a normal amount of rain; January is the month that gets the most rain, and the driest month of the year is June.
